Examples of Overrun Quantity in a sentence

  • Overrun Quantity means each quantity of Gas which is delivered to or on account of Shipper at each Delivery Point in respect of a Service on a Day in excess of the quantity of Gas scheduled to be delivered, and not curtailed in accordance with this Agreement, to that Delivery Point on that Day to or on account of Shipper under that Service.

  • No transfer of any rights in relation to Authorised Overrun Quantity is permitted.

  • An Unauthorised Overrun will occur where the User incurs an Overrun Quantity on a Day or in an Hour which is not an Authorised Overrun.

  • If on any Day the Customer has a Withdrawal Overrun Quantity greater than zero (0), SL shall sell to the Customer the Withdrawal Overrun Quantity from SL at a purchase price calculated in accordance with the following formula: PDQSMAX(D) = (1.25 x SMBP + (Withdrawal Charge + Injection Charge)) x DQSMAX(D) where: PDQSMAX(D) is the Withdrawal Overrun Quantity purchase price in pence; SMBP(D) System Marginal Buy Price in pence/kWh on such Day; and DQSMAX(D) is the Withdrawal Overrun Quantity in kWh.

  • For any Unauthorised Overrun Service, the relevant User shall pay an unauthorised overrun charge equal to the Overrun Quantity multiplied by the Unauthorised Overrun Rate.


More Definitions of Overrun Quantity

Overrun Quantity means an Entry Capacity Overrun Quantity, a LDM Exit Capacity Overrun Quantity, a DM Exit Capacity Overrun Quantity, a NDM Exit Capacity Overrun Quantity or a Supply Point Capacity Overrun Quantity (as the case may be);
Overrun Quantity means any quantity of natural gas of which the Buyer takes delivery at the Delivery Point on any Delivery Date in excess of the MDQ.
Overrun Quantity or "Excess Gas" shall mean any quantity that is not within Customer's entitlements as specified in Customer's Firm Storage Service Agreement or Customer’s No-Notice Storage Service Agreement, as applicable. Such quantities shall be deemed as interruptible service.
